What are the Key Benefits of Buying a Health Insurance Policy Online?

Buying health insurance online helps you to compare health insurance plans easily, get detailed information, promote cost-effectiveness, and so on. Let us understand them in more detail:

Easy Plan Comparison

When you purchase health insurance online, you may compare many policies side by side. You may use tools provided by websites to compare policies from multiple insurers or even plans offered by the same provider. You might choose policies based on criteria, cost, inclusions, and exclusions.

Detailed Information

There is a lot of information available on the internet on the benefits and drawbacks of health insurance. FAQs, user evaluations, and comprehensive policy papers are available online. Additionally, you may get specific coverage descriptions, exclusions, terms, and conditions.

Cost-Effectiveness

Cost-effectiveness is another important advantage of buying health insurance online. Traditionally, individuals purchase health insurance through agents, which increases policy costs.

On the other hand, online purchases reduce overhead by doing away with the necessity for middlemen. Customers frequently receive these savings in the form of competitive rates.

Paperless Process

Online health insurance purchases can be quick and paperless, which saves your time in completing forms and submitting documents. This procedure lowers the possibility of mistakes and delays while saving time.

Personalization

You may add more coverage for serious illnesses, maternity benefits, or a larger sum covered to your health insurance policy online. One advantage of purchasing health insurance early in life is that you may start with a basic plan and add riders or improve coverage as your requirements change.

Things to Consider While Buying Health Insurance Online

Sum Insured

The sum insured is the highest amount your health insurance provider will cover for medical costs over the course of the policy. You must verify this before buying health insurance online.

It is important to evaluate your demands and select a sum covered that fits your lifestyle and future medical expenses. For example, choosing a larger sum covered is advised if you reside in a city with greater healthcare expenditures.

Waiting Period

You should constantly consider the waiting time when buying health insurance for your family or yourself. The insurance does not accept any non-accidental claims during this time, particularly those of certain illnesses.

Pre- and Post-Hospitalisation Cover

Hospital stays are not the only expense associated with hospitalisation. Your medical fees may go up if you have medical expenses both before and after being admitted to the hospital. Therefore, it is important to confirm if your medical insurance coverage covers pre-hospitalisation and post-hospitalisation fees before buying one.

Restoration Benefits

A helpful feature is the restoration benefit, which allows the insurance provider to reimburse the full sum covered in the event that it is depleted during a claim.

For example, if you utilise the whole Rs. 5 lakh coverage of your parents’ health insurance policy for a single treatment, the insurer would reimburse you. This enables you to make another claim for further medical requirements before the policy’s renewal.

No-Claim Bonus

Before making a purchase, check your mediclaim insurance for the no-claim bonus (NCB) or cumulative bonus. For each year without a claim, your insurer will give you an NCB on your renewal premium.

Common Mistakes to Avoid While Buying Health Insurance Online

Focusing Only on the Cheapest Plans

You should find out why the coverage is inexpensive before purchasing it, not after a claim is denied.

Not Disclosing Pre-Existing Conditions

Since they do not know what matters, people neglect outdated protocols, disregard ambiguous circumstances, or omit specifics. However, one of the most straightforward grounds for an insurer to lower or reject a claim in the event of a disagreement later on is non-disclosure.

Buying Little Cover

A short hospital stay in a metro area might quickly deplete a small amount of insurance. While minimal coverage may still be beneficial, it may also result in significant out-of-pocket expenses.

Buying Add-Ons Blindly

Selecting add-ons that shield you from typical claim cuts rather than those that seem amazing is the best course of action.

Missing Room Rent Limits

Many individuals believe that if they choose a costly room, they will just pay the difference. In reality, some plans employ proportional discounts, in which the insurance lowers many portions of the payment due to the room category exceeding eligibility.
